I’ve been reading everyone’s views on how everyone feels that the Forums were going too far up in popularity and quantity but down in quality. I understand why these forums are here and what purpose they serve so maybe the increased popularity is good for the Special Reserve Network by basically getting pretty good advertising for practically free.

But I think that the fact that so many Notables and respected Regulars are leaving because of the problems that are being brought up is harmful to the forums rather than anything else and SR will be losing respect and loyal customers, this isn’t their fault but instead because of the he influx of Newbies and coming in every day and posting absolutely useless topics which simply clog up the forums and kill the good topics that are actually about entertainment.

Er-No, one of the few Notables left, mentioned something about a forum for people who were here in the ‘old days’ and I thought about this, that idea could be expanded into having a locked forums only for people who have been around for over 450 days and Notables. Another way people could enter this forums is by ‘voted’ into it by the members with a new member of the forum every month or so. This would definitely bring up the quality of the forums since people will have to impress the SR staff and the members of this Exclusive forum.

Another thing that can be fixed is the Newbie-Regular system. These days Newbies turn into Regulars when they write a certain number of words or in most cases spam for 10,000 words and 300 posts. Why don’t we have a system where a new batch of Newbies turn into Regulars every week or so, where there is a sort of election like the notable election on a smaller scale and the nominees are hand picked by the staff? This would stop.

There was also a long conversation between some of us and Grix about having to be a member of SR to join the forums. Wouldn’t that be better for all of us? Firstly we’d lose a lot of spammers who wouldn’t be bothered to pay to spam and SR would get some money back to pay for the GADs and maybe could we have an extra CAM (Console a Month) prize? I know most of us will loose a lot of good friends through people not being able to pay for the forums but then again you can open another forum for non-members who haven’t paid. Get what I mean?

Anyway I know this post will not be taken as seriously as it would be if it was written by a notable or someone who’s been here for longer but although I have only been here for only 98 days I can also see signs of the forums generally going down.
